Motorcycle rider killed in collision Caledon OPP and OPP Technical Collision Investigators are continuing their investigation of a fatal motor vehicle collision Thursday, June 28 at roughly 5:24 p.m. on Humber Station Road, south of Castlederg Sideroad in Caledon. A southbound motorcycle collided with the trailer of a northbound dump truck on Humber Station Road. Tragically, the motorcycle rider, 24-year-old Kyle Fagan of Mulmur Township, did not survive and was pronounced dead after being transported to Headwaters Hospital in Orangeville. The dump truck driver, 54-year-old Augustus Quintan of Brampton, was not injured. The investigation is continuing. Any further witnesses to the collision are asked to contact the investigating officer, Constable P. Beaton of Caledon OPP at 905-584-2241. |
